Abstract

Simultaneous single-shot measurements of pulse-front tilt and pulse duration of ultrashort laser pulses are performed using a single-shot autocorrelator. It uses non-collinear second-harmonic generation by overlapping an ultrashort laser pulse with its spatially inverted replica in a KDP crystal. The pulse-front tilt is determined from the rotation angle of the axis of the elliptical shaped autocorrelation trace. Performance of the system is demonstrated from measurements of the pulse duration and known pulse-front tilt introduced in 250 fs (FWHM) transform-limited laser pulses from a CW mode-locked Nd:glass laser.
